WebThey call their language the "Ottoman tongue" - Othmanli dilce - though some did speak of it as the Turkish. The Ottoman Empire had Turkish origins and Islamic foundations, but from the start it was a heterogeneous mixture of ethnic groups and religious creeds. Ethnicity was determined solely by religious affiliation. WebThe Sultan silenced by the voice of the people; Ottoman, the tongue of a chosen few, was a language barrier to development Person as author : Altan, Cetin ... Ottoman was used at court and among the élite, but nowhere else. The people spoke Turkish. Unlike Latin and ancient Greek, Ot¬ toman was not an "archaic" tongue.
